Manager, IT Client Services

The Information Technology (IT) Client Services Manager manages and maintains an operational support team that addresses and resolves technical support IT-related issues of the entire Halifax Health workforce in a timely manner. The IT service desk team is responsible for the deployment and 1st level support of hardware, software, network, telecommunication and all other IT systems. Along with the IT leadership team, the IT Client Services manager develops an effective and workable framework for managing and improving customer IT support in the organization.
Additionally, the Client Services manager is responsible for Service Level Management (SLM). This entails monitoring and measuring the Halifax Health IT operational performance against an established Service Level Agreement and Operating Level Agreement (SLA/OLA). This position is responsible for developing, monitoring, and maintaining all department-level metrics, and review of all department documentation to ensure standardization, currency, relevancy and accuracy of all standards and procedures.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ILTIES:

Coordinate and maintain relationships with Halifax Health users and vendors to ensure the proper and timely completion of customer requirements and problem resolution.

Prepare reports and analyses setting forth progress, adverse trends and appropriate recommendations or conclusions. Determine fiscal requirements and prepare budgetary recommendations; monitor, verify and reconcile expenditures of budgeted funds.

Develop and monitor internal and external training programs to ensure that new personnel are oriented to departmental procedures and personnel within the departmental unit are informed concerning changing information systems technologies.

Recommend various personnel actions including but not limited to hiring, work assignments, performance appraisals, promotions and disciplinary actions; train new employees and monitor performance appraisals.

Act as an integral member of the Halifax Health IT Disaster Recovery Team, participating in the development and execution of Halifax Health disaster recovery plans and procedures.

Promote and adhere to departmental and organizational information security policies, standards, and procedures.

Perform other related duties incidental to the work described herein.
